Litton, North Yorkshire

Litton is a village and civil parish in Littondale in the Yorkshire Dales in England. It lies in the Craven district of North Yorkshire, up Littondale from Arncliffe. From Litton a footpath leads over the fells to the north east to Buckden in Wharfedale. The population of the civil parish was estimated at 70 in 2012.
The centre of the village is an old public house, the Queens Arms, that dates back to the 17th century. Associated with the Queens Arms since 2003 is the Litton Brewery that brews Litton Ale.
Litton was historically a township in the ancient parish of Arncliffe, part of Staincliffe Wapentake in the West Riding of Yorkshire.〔(【引用サイトリンク】title=Imperial Gazetteer of England and Wales )〕 Litton became a separate civil parish in 1866.〔(Vision of Britain website )〕
The parish was transferred to the new county of North Yorkshire in 1974.
